    • The present invention provides a method for easily and inexpensively preparing a racemate or an optically-active 2-(1 -hydroxyethyl)-5-hydroxynaphtho[2,3-b]furan-4,9-dione in high yields, 2-acetyl-2,3-dihydro-5-hydroxynaphtho[2,3-b]furan-4,9-dione which is useful as an intermediate for preparing NFD, and an anticancer agent comprising 2-(1-hydroxyethyl)-5-hydroxynaphtho[2,3-b]furan-4,9-dione as an active ingredient.Said 2-(1-hydroxyethyl)-5-hydroxynaphtho[2,3-b]furan-4,9-dione is obtained in 4 or 5 steps by using comparatively inexpensive 5 -hydroxynaphthalene-1,4-dione (also referred to as juglone) as a starting material.

    • The invention relates to a method of determining the effect of betanins on tumor formation in epidermal tissue in mammals which have been exposed to a substance which initiates or promotes tumor formation by sequentially exposing a first group of mammals to a topically applied chemical substance selected from the group consisting of tumor promoters and tumor initiators; providing the first group of mammals with drinking water containing betanins, said betanin having been extracted from beetroot; measuring a percentage of mammals in the first group which exhibit epidermal tumors; and comparing the percentage of mammals in the first group which exhibit epidermal tumors to a percentage of mammals in a second group which exhibit epidermal tumors, said mammals in the second group having been (a) exposed to a chemical substance selected from the group consisting of tumor promoters and tumor initiators and (b) providing with drinking water containing no betanins.
